Which of the following most accurately describes when a debit card transaction takes effect? a. The transaction is completed alm

ost immediately after making the purchase. b. The transaction takes two to three business days to clear. c. All debit card transactions are processed simultaneously at the end of the day. d. Debit card transactions are completed when you pay your monthly debit card bill.
Mathematics
2 answers:
nika2105 [10]3 years ago
8 0
The sentence on letter A most accurately describes when a debit card transaction takes effect.
>The transaction is completed almost immediately after making the purchase.

>A debit card is a plastic payment card that provides cardholders electronic access to their bank account(s) at a financial institution. Some cards may bear a stored value with which a payment is made, while most relay a message to the cardholder's bank to withdraw funds from a payer's designated bank account.

Consider the quadratic function f(y) = 8y2 – 7y + 6. What is the constant of the function?
UNO [17]
The answer would be 6 because it has no variable. The formula for a quadratic function is f(x)=ax^2 +bx+ c, c which in this case is the constant because it has no variable.
